Game Designer, Activities

Epic Games · Multiple locations ·

Pay:
$107,812-$158,124/yr
Job type:
Full Time

What You'll Do
Epic Games is seeking a Senior Game Designer, Activities Design to join our dynamic team and contribute to various aspects of objectives and encounter design for our collaboration with Disney. In this role, you'll leverage your experience, design tool expertise, and a sense of gameplay to elevate the game's quality and delight players with fresh experiences.

In this role, you will

Drive objectives and encounters to advance the project's gameplay and in-game progression

Deliver varied and scalable content across worlds to enhance design velocity as the project grows

Quickly iterate on encounter and objective design elements while upholding the high Epic quality standards on a project of this scale

Shape compelling and replayable experiences that align with Epic and Disney’s long-term gameplay vision

What we’re looking for

Minimum of 4+ years’ experience shipping multiple AAA titles as a game designer

Proficiency in using major game engines (e.g., UE5)

Visual scripting experience is a must

Deep experience in PvPvE objective and encounter design, crucial for the project's evolving scope

Demonstrated ability to improvise and creatively solve problems

Strong problem‑solving skills and a solution‑oriented mindset, with the ability to adapt quickly to changing project needs
